The Industry Has Entered a “Trend Reaction Cycle”

In the past, wholesale cycles were relatively stable. A product could stay in the market for years without major changes.

That is no longer the case.

Trends Now Replace Product Lifecycles

In modern smoking accessories wholesale, product lifecycles are increasingly shaped by:

  • Social media aesthetics
  • Influencer-driven designs
  • Retail visual merchandising trends
  • Seasonal consumer behavior shifts

A design that is popular today may lose traction within months. This forces suppliers and distributors to operate in a continuous redesign loop rather than a fixed catalog model.

Glass Pipe Wholesale: Small Product, Fast Movement, High Sensitivity

Within the broader industry, glass pipe wholesale behaves like a “trend amplifier.”

Why Glass Pipes React Faster Than Other Categories

Glass pipes are:

  • Lower priced
  • Easier to redesign visually
  • More sensitive to aesthetic trends
  • Highly influenced by impulse buying

Because of this, they often reflect market changes earlier than larger products like bongs.

A small change in color, shape, or pattern can significantly affect sales performance in retail environments.

Why Flexibility Is Now More Valuable Than Volume

Large production capacity is still important—but flexibility has become equally critical.

The Problem With Over-Production Models

Traditional wholesale systems rely on large batches. But in a trend-driven market, this creates risk:

  • Inventory becomes outdated
  • Designs lose relevance
  • Capital gets locked in unsold stock

This is especially visible in glass pipe wholesale, where visual trends shift quickly.

Flexible Manufacturing as a Survival Strategy

Modern suppliers need to support:

  • Small batch production
  • Frequent design updates
  • Modular product variations
  • Fast reordering systems

Flexibility reduces risk while improving responsiveness to market signals.
